Heartbeat

The heartbeat service sends a regular heartbeat signal to each and every agent. It wakes up the agent and re-evaluates its rules.

This enables the agents to have time-based rules and act proactively. For example, if a user had a technical issue 2 days ago and no follow-up was made, the agent can ask the user if everything is okay now.

How it works

Each agent has its own heartbeat signal, and can be scheduled independently. By default, the Uniform heartbeat strategy is used, which schedules heartbeats at a regular interval. The interval can be configured with the HEARTBEAT_CYCLE environment variable (see config.yaml). The default value is 30 seconds.

The Heartbeat service works by periodically querying the database of schedules and sending the signals whose next execution time has passed. It does this every HEARTBEAT_PRECISION_MS milliseconds (default: 1000), which means that the actual heartbeat time may lag for up to 1 second during normal operational load, which is acceptable for most use cases.

Strategies

Uniform

This is currently the only available strategy, which schedules heartbeats at a regular interval.

Custom strategies

You can implement custom strategies by extending the HeartbeatStrategy class.

For example, to increase the heartbeat frequency only for the Smith agent, put the following in services/heartbeat/smith_strategy.py:

from datetime import datetime, timedelta

from forge.utils.datetime import now
from heartbeat import settings
from heartbeat.base import HeartbeatStrategy
from rule_engine.api import Evaluation


class SmithStrategy(HeartbeatStrategy):

def get_next_heartbeat(self, evaluation: Evaluation) -> datetime:
if evaluation.agentId == 'Smith':
return now() + timedelta(seconds=5)
return now() + timedelta(seconds=settings.HEARTBEAT_CYCLE)

Don't forget to set HEARTBEAT_STRATEGY to SmithStrategy in config.yaml.

There is also an abstract strategy Priority which you can extend to implement a priority-based strategy. An agent with priority 1 is evaluated every HEARTBEAT_CYCLE seconds, an agent with priority 2 is evaluated twice as much, etc. Priorities smaller than 1 are allowed, as long as they're greater than zero.

Checks and alerts

Before sending the heartbeat signal, the service checks if the signal is lagging for more than HEARTBEAT_PRECISION_MS milliseconds.

If it is, it will log a warning. If it's lagging for more than 2 times the HEARTBEAT_PRECISION_MS time, it will log an error and send an alert. You can control the maximum number of alerts with the HEARTBEAT_LAG_ERR_MAX_EVERY_SECS environment variable. Keep in mind that if the service restarts, the counter is reset, and it may send an alert immediately.

API

Calls

There are currently no calls you can make to the Heartbeat service.

Events

Heartbeat

class Heartbeat(Event):
agentId: str

The Heartbeat event is emitted when a heartbeat signal for an agent is sent.

HeartbeatModel

class HeartbeatModel(EmittableDataModel):
agentId: str
nextHeartbeatAt: datetime

The HeartbeatModel data change is emitted when a new heartbeat signal is scheduled for an agent.

Settings

  • HEARTBEAT_STRATEGY - The strategy to use for scheduling heartbeats. The default is Uniform.
  • HEARTBEAT_PRECISION_MS - How often the service queries the scheduled heartbeats. The default is 1000 milliseconds.
  • HEARTBEAT_MAX_USERS_PER_LOOP - The maximum number of users to process in a single loop. Can be used to limit burst loads to the system. This may increase the maximum heartbeat time lag above the HEARTBEAT_PRECISION_MS time. The default is 0 (no limit).
  • HEARTBEAT_LAG_ERR_MAX_EVERY_SECS - The minimum time between lag alerts (see Checks and alerts). The default is 3600 seconds (1 hour).
  • HEARTBEAT_CYCLE - If using the Uniform strategy, the interval between heartbeats. The default is 30 seconds.

There is also a feature toggle HeartbeatEnabled which you can use to control heartbeats for all (or specific) agents.
